"Detective Kitty O'Day" is not a great mystery (the murderer is fairly easy to spot after a point, especially when the other suspects keep getting bumped off!), but it doesn't need to be: it's the comedy that primarily carries this picture, and it carries it well. The dialogue is snappy and the pacing is breezy. More specifically, just about every line uttered by the clueless but good natured cop played by Ed Gargan is funny to very funny ("I wanted to get you out of that hot closet before you sophisticated!"). Jean Parker is absolutely adorable as the title character: beautiful, spunky, brave, and deeply devoted to her boyfriend; near the end, she's not afraid to get physical with the bad guys using her handbag as a weapon! The "official" DVD print of the movie, included in a "Poverty Row" collection with two others, has a couple of bad splices, but they don't detract much. *** out of 4.
